12-BIT, 28 MSPS SAMPLING A/D CONVERTER
FEATURES
3.0-3.6 V Power Supply Typical SINAD: 60 dB for (fIN = 10 MHz) Low power: (260 mW @3.3 V) Sample Rate: 28 MSPS Internal Sample/Hold Differential Input Sleep Mode (Power Down)
APPLICATIONS
Imaging Test Equipment Computer Scanners Communications Set-Top Boxes
GENERAL DESCRIPTION
The SPT7936 is a compact, high-speed, low power 12-bit monolithic analog-to-digital converter, implemented in a 0.5 µm CMOS process. The converter includes sample and hold. The full scale range can be set between ±0.6 V and ±1.2 V using external references. It operates from a single 3.0-3.6 V supply-compatible with modern digital systems. Most converters in this performance range demand at least a +5 V supply. Its low distortion and high dynamic range offers the
performance needed for demanding imaging, multimedia, telecommunications and instrumentation applications. The SPT7936 has a pipelined architecture - resulting in low input capacitance. Digital error correction of the 11 most significant bits ensures good linearity for input frequencies approaching Nyquist. The device is available in a 44L TQFP package over the commercial temperature range of 0 to +70 °C.
